Google has refused to release the source code of Android 3.x , aka Honeycomb.
Android been opensource, this is expected.
Google gives a very B*tchy excuse in the form that if they release the course, open source developers will port the OS to phones. The OS was done specifically for tablets and made some compromises which will give users a bad user experience on phones, and Google cares so much it doesn't want to cause this.
